Since it began astounding the world with its rapid economic growth over two decades ago, China has become a popular destination for those looking to work abroad. As the nation continues to gain power and influence on the world stage, the number of people heading to the Middle Kingdom to reap the rewards of its booming employment market is simply growing. There’s no doubt that professional opportunity is rife but finding a job in China is no easy feat. In fact, it requires a lot of research, preparation and most of all, perseverance.
